OPT to showcase wave tech in Houston

PB3 PowerBuoy (Photo: OPT)

 
Ocean Power Technologies (OPT) will exhibit its PB3 commercial PowerBuoy at Offshore Technology Conference (OTC) in Houston, Texas.

OPT has developed a PB3 PowerBuoy that harvests the energy of the waves, and can act as both power and communication platform for remote offshore applications such as advanced multi-functional sensors, modular chemical injection systems for subsea operations, and docking stations for subsea drones.

The US-based wave energy developer is mainly interested in oil and gas, defense and security, ocean observing, and communications markets.

To remind, in February 2017 OPT formed a strategic alliance with HAI Technologies to explore mutual opportunities in the oil and gas sector, with a focus on offshore oil and gas subsea chemical injection systems where persistent power and real-time data communications are critical.

The Offshore Technology Conference will be held from May 1 through May 5, 2017.
